Springfield, IL (CAPITOL CITY NOW) – Springfield Police report a suspect in one bank robbery has not been located but all suspects in another one have been taken into custody.
Officers responded to a hold-up alarm around 4:40pm October 9th at the US Bank on E North Grand. The suspect was said to be a man wearing a mask and escaped with several thousand dollars but has not yet been identified.
Then Saturday morning ten minutes before noon, Police responded to a robbery at Clock Tower Community Bank on Monroe Street.
A witness provided the getaway vehicle’s information to officers, who stopped the vehicle near the intersection of Pasfield and Monroe. 35-year-old Jacob Ortiz-Wilson and 32-year-old Shaea Keyes, both of Danville, exited the vehicle and were arrested.
A 3rd suspect, 33-year-old Winston Douglas of LaSalle fled in the vehicle but was taken into custody when it was disabled near Pasfield and Jefferson Streets.
